Identifying and Documenting Your Raw Materials

Before you can build, you must know your parts. This initial phase involves a thorough inventory of every single raw material and component that makes up your homemade good. Think of it as dissecting your product to its core elements.

  • Brainstorm and List: Start by listing every ingredient, fabric, piece of hardware, or packaging element. For a handmade soap, this might include oils, lye, essential oils, colorants, and packaging. For a knitted item, it’s the yarn, buttons, labels, and even the thread used for sewing.
  • Categorize: Group similar items to streamline the process (e.g., all oils, all hardware).
  • Specify Details: Don’t just list "fabric"; specify "100% organic cotton canvas, natural color." The more detail you capture now, the easier it will be to maintain consistency later. This initial documentation becomes the bedrock for your comprehensive Bill of Materials.

Creating a Comprehensive Bill of Materials (BOM)

The Bill of Materials (BOM) is more than just a list; it’s a living document that serves as the definitive inventory of all components, sub-assemblies, and raw materials required to produce a single unit of your homemade good. It’s your product’s DNA.

A robust BOM typically includes:

  • Item Name/Description: A clear, unambiguous name for each material or component.
  • Quantity per Unit: How much of each item is needed for one finished product. Be precise (e.g., 5 ml, 200 grams, 1 piece).
  • Unit of Measure: The specific unit for the quantity (e.g., grams, milliliters, meters, pieces).
  • Supplier: The primary vendor or source for that material.
  • Cost per Unit: The cost of that specific material or component as purchased from the supplier, often broken down to the quantity used per product.

Sample Bill of Materials for a "Lavender Bliss Soy Candle"

To illustrate, consider a hypothetical homemade product like a scented soy candle:

Material/Component Quantity per Unit Unit Supplier Cost per Unit (as used)
Soy Wax Flakes 150 grams EcoWax Supplies $0.80
Lavender Essential Oil 5 ml AromaPure Oils $1.20
Cotton Wick (pre-tabbed) 1 piece WickMaster Co. $0.15
Amber Glass Jar (8oz) 1 piece GlassCraft Containers $0.75
Lid (matching amber jar) 1 piece GlassCraft Containers $0.10
Product Label (waterproof) 1 piece PrintPerfect Labels $0.05
Total Material Cost per Unit $3.05

This table provides a snapshot of the direct material costs for a single candle, critical for pricing and cost management.

Specifying Acceptable Tolerances

No manufacturing process is perfectly precise. Therefore, simply stating a dimension isn’t enough; you must also define the acceptable range of variation, known as "tolerances." These are the permissible upper and lower limits for each dimension.

  • Ensuring Consistency: Tolerances guarantee that all units produced are functionally identical and consistent in appearance, even if minor variations occur during production.
  • Fit and Assembly: For products with multiple parts, tight tolerances ensure that components fit together correctly during assembly, preventing gaps, misalignment, or forcing parts.
  • Preventing Waste: By defining acceptable variations, you reduce the likelihood of rejecting parts that are perfectly functional but slightly deviate from the nominal dimension, thereby reducing material waste and production costs.

Consider the following example for a sample product’s dimensions and tolerances:

Dimension Standard Measurement Acceptable Tolerance Rationale/Impact
Product: Smart Home Hub
Length 120 mm ± 0.5 mm Ensures device fits designated shelf/mount, visual consistency.
Width 120 mm ± 0.5 mm Maintains square form factor, critical for aesthetic and footprint.
Height 45 mm ± 0.3 mm User interaction comfort, avoids interference with other devices or cables.
Weight 350 grams ± 5 grams Perceived quality, shipping cost accuracy, ensures internal component stability.
Volume (approx.) 648 cm³ N/A (derived) Influences packaging material usage and storage density.

Setting Concrete Performance Standards

Beyond simply "working," how well does your product need to perform? Setting performance standards means quantifying your quality expectations.

  • Quantifiable Goals: Instead of "good scent," specify "scent noticeable within 10 minutes in a 10×12 ft room." For durability, it might be "able to withstand 5 washes without pilling or fading."
  • Align with Customer Expectations: These standards should not only reflect your own high bar but also align with what your target customers expect and value most in your product category.

Managing Imperfection: Defect Rates and Non-Conforming Products

Even with the best processes, some items may not meet your rigorous standards. How you handle these "non-conforming" products is a critical part of quality control.

  • Acceptable Defect Rates: Determine a realistic, low percentage of acceptable imperfections. This acknowledges the human element of handmade goods while still pushing for excellence.
  • Clear Procedures:
    • Identify: Have a process for clearly identifying products that don’t meet standards.
    • Segregate: Physically separate non-conforming items to prevent them from reaching customers.
    • Decision: Decide whether the item can be reworked, sold as a "second" (with full transparency), or discarded. Never compromise your brand by selling a substandard product without clear disclosure.

Integrating Customer Feedback for Continuous Improvement

Your customers are an invaluable resource for quality control. Their experiences offer real-world insights into your product’s performance and areas for improvement.

  • Establish Feedback Channels: Make it easy for customers to provide feedback through surveys, reviews, social media, or direct communication.
  • Active Listening: Pay close attention to recurring comments, both positive and negative.
  • Closed-Loop System: Use this feedback to refine your QC criteria, adjust your production methods, or even innovate new features. This continuous loop ensures your products evolve to meet and exceed user expectations.

To illustrate, here’s a simple Quality Control checklist for a common homemade item:

Homemade Candle Quality Control Log

This checklist helps ensure each hand-poured soy candle meets predefined quality and safety standards before it reaches a customer.

QC Checkpoint Criteria / Standard Pass / Fail Notes / Action Required
Visual Inspection Smooth top, centered wick, no frosting/wet spots.
Container Integrity No cracks, chips, or visible defects in the container.
Wick Placement Wick perfectly centered and secured at the bottom.
Label Adhesion Label applied smoothly, securely, and readable.
Scent (Cold Throw) Noticeable, consistent scent when unlit.
Net Weight Within +/- 5% of advertised weight (e.g., 8 oz ± 0.4 oz).
Burn Test (Sample) Even melt pool (to edge within 2-3 hrs), stable flame. (Conducted on a batch sample)
Burn Time (Sample) Meets advertised burn duration (e.g., 40-50 hours). (Conducted on a batch sample)
Safety Warning Safety label clearly affixed and legible.

Securing Your Product: Closure Mechanisms and Tamper-Evident Features

The integrity and safety of your product depend heavily on its closure mechanisms and tamper-evident features. These are vital for maintaining freshness, preventing contamination, and assuring consumers of the product’s untouched state.

  • Closure Types: Select appropriate closures such as screw caps, snap-on lids, heat seals, zippers, or re-sealable adhesive strips, considering product access, child safety, and preservation needs.
  • Tamper-Evident Seals: Integrate features that visibly indicate if a package has been opened or altered before purchase. Examples include:
    • Shrink bands: Plastic bands that encase bottle caps or container lids, tearing when opened.
    • Induction seals: Foil seals melted onto the rim of a container, requiring puncturing to access the product.
    • Security labels: Labels that leave a "VOID" message if peeled off.
    • Tear strips or perforations: Designed to break or deform irreversibly upon first opening.
    • Blister packs: Individual plastic and foil enclosures that are difficult to re-seal once opened.
  • Ease of Use vs. Security: Balance robust security with the consumer’s ability to easily open and use the product.

The Foundation: Mandatory Labeling Requirements

The first step in effective labeling is understanding the non-negotiable legal requirements for your specific product type and target region. These mandatory elements vary significantly based on whether you’re selling food, cosmetics, candles, or other crafts, and whether you’re operating locally, nationally, or internationally. Ignoring these can lead to fines, product recalls, and severe damage to your reputation.

Common mandatory requirements often include:

  • Ingredients List: For food and cosmetics, a comprehensive list of all ingredients, typically in descending order of predominance by weight.
  • Nutritional Facts: For food products, a standardized panel detailing calories, fats, carbohydrates, proteins, and key vitamins and minerals.
  • Net Quantity: The weight, volume, or count of the product contained within the package.
  • ‘Made In’ Origin: The country where the product was manufactured or largely processed.
  • Manufacturer/Distributor Information: Name and contact details (address, city, state, zip code) of the responsible party.
  • Batch or Lot Number: An identifier for traceability, crucial in case of recalls or quality control issues.
  • Date Marking: "Best before," "Use by," or "Manufacture date" where applicable for perishable goods.

To illustrate the variety, consider these common categories of homemade goods and their typical labeling demands:

Product Category Common Labeling Requirements Categories Typical Content
Food & Edibles Ingredients, Nutritional Facts, Net Weight, Allergen Declaration, Manufacturer Info, Date Marking, Storage Instructions Full list of ingredients (descending order), standardized nutrition panel, exact weight/volume, ‘contains’ statement for common allergens (e.g., milk, nuts), your business name/address, "Best By" or "Use By" date, "Keep Refrigerated" instructions.
Cosmetics & Personal Care Ingredients (INCI), Net Content, Usage Directions, Warnings, Manufacturer Info, Batch Number International Nomenclature Cosmetic Ingredient (INCI) list, weight/volume, "Apply to clean skin," "For external use only," "Discontinue if irritation occurs," your business name/address, unique identifier for batch traceability.
Home & Craft Goods Materials, Care Instructions, Origin, Warnings (if applicable), Manufacturer Info List of primary materials (e.g., "100% Cotton," "Soy Wax"), washing/cleaning instructions, "Made in [Country]," "Keep away from children" (for small parts/choking hazards), "Do not leave unattended" (for candles), your business name/address.

Thorough research into local, national, and international regulations relevant to your specific product is not just recommended, it’s essential. Consult government agencies (like the FDA in the US, FSA in the UK, Health Canada) or legal professionals specializing in product labeling.

Understanding Specific Legal Compliance Obligations

The legal landscape for homemade goods is diverse, varying significantly based on the type of product you sell. What applies to a homemade jam might not apply to a knitted baby toy, and vice-versa. It’s essential to pinpoint the exact regulations that govern your specific creations.

  • Food Safety: If you produce edible items, you’ll need to understand food safety laws. This often involves adherence to local "cottage food laws," which permit the sale of certain low-risk foods made in a home kitchen, usually with specific sales channel restrictions and labeling requirements. Federal oversight from the Food and Drug Administration (FDA) applies to inter-state sales and certain product categories, while state and local health departments set specific standards for home-based food businesses, including kitchen inspections and food handler certifications.
  • Toy Safety: For children’s products, especially toys, safety is paramount. The Consumer Product Safety Commission (CPSC) sets stringent federal standards, including requirements for lead content, phthalates, small parts (choking hazards), sharp points or edges, and flammability. Products for children under three years old face additional scrutiny.
  • Cosmetic Regulations: Homemade soaps, lotions, balms, and other personal care products fall under the FDA’s purview as cosmetics. While cosmetics don’t require pre-market approval, they must be safe for their intended use, properly labeled with an ingredient list, and produced in sanitary conditions. Certain ingredients are restricted or prohibited.
  • Other Regulations: Depending on your product, you might encounter other specific regulations. For instance, jewelry may have lead or cadmium content restrictions, textiles might require specific fiber content and care labeling from the Federal Trade Commission (FTC), and electronic items could fall under Federal Communications Commission (FCC) regulations.

Researching Relevant Regulatory Bodies

Identifying and understanding the requirements of relevant regulatory bodies is a cornerstone of compliance. These agencies are your primary sources for official guidelines and standards.

The Consumer Product Safety Commission (CPSC) is a critical agency for anyone making products intended for use by children or that could pose a safety hazard to consumers. Their website offers extensive guidance, educational resources, and a database of product recalls, which can help you identify potential risks. Similarly, the Food and Drug Administration (FDA) provides comprehensive information on food, drug, and cosmetic regulations. For local food businesses, your State Department of Health or Agriculture and Local Health Departments are invaluable resources. Don’t overlook industry-specific associations, which often provide simplified guides to complex regulations.

Here’s a table summarizing key compliance areas and their primary regulatory bodies for homemade goods:

Compliance Area Key Regulatory Body(ies) Applicable Homemade Goods Examples
Food Safety FDA (federal), USDA (meat/poultry), State/Local Health Depts. Baked goods, jams, jellies, sauces, confections, preserved foods
Children’s Products/Toy Safety Consumer Product Safety Commission (CPSC) Toys, baby clothes, rattles, pacifier clips, children’s furniture
Cosmetic Safety Food and Drug Administration (FDA) Soaps, lotions, balms, makeup, perfumes, bath bombs
Textile & Apparel Labeling Federal Trade Commission (FTC) Clothing, fabric items, blankets, pet apparel
General Business Licensing State Business Bureaus, Local Municipalities All homemade goods businesses (business license, permits)
Jewelry Safety (e.g., Lead) Consumer Product Safety Commission (CPSC), State Regulations Necklaces, bracelets, earrings, particularly for children

Considering Product Liability Insurance and Intellectual Property Rights

Beyond direct product regulations, two crucial aspects for safeguarding your business are product liability insurance and intellectual property rights.

  • Product Liability Insurance: Even with meticulous safety measures, accidents can happen. Product liability insurance protects your business financially in the event that your homemade good causes injury or damage to a consumer. It can cover legal fees, medical expenses, and settlement costs, preventing a single incident from derailing your entire venture. This is especially vital for products that are ingested, applied to the body, or used by children.
  • Intellectual Property Rights: Protecting your unique designs, brand name, and creative works is as important as protecting your consumers. This includes:
    • Trademarks: Protecting your business name, logo, or slogan.
    • Copyrights: Protecting original artistic or literary works, such as unique product designs, patterns, or even website content.
    • Design Patents: Protecting the unique ornamental design of a manufactured item.
      Understanding and securing your intellectual property (IP) prevents others from copying your hard work and gives you exclusive rights to your innovations. Conversely, you must also ensure your products do not infringe on the IP rights of others.
